Against the supposition(假设)that forest fires in Alaska, Canada and Siberia warm the climate, scientists have discovered that cooling may occur in areas where burnt trees allow more snow to mirror more sunlight into space.
This finding suggests that taking steps to prevent northern forest to limit the release of greenhouse gases may warm the climate in northern regions. Usually large fires destroyed forests in these areas over the past decade. Scientists predict that with climate warming, fires may occur more frequently over next several centuries as a result of a longer fire season. Sunlight taken in by the earth tends to cause warming, while heat mirrored back into space tends to cause cooling.
This is the first study to analyze all aspects of how northern fires influence climate. Earlier studies by other scientists have suggested that fire in northern regions speed up climate warming because greenhouse gases from burning trees and plants are released into the atmosphere and thus trap heat.
Scientists found that right after the fire, large amounts of greenhouse gases entered the atmosphere and caused warming. Ozone(臭氧)levels increased, and ash from the fire fell on far-off sea ice, darkening the surface and causing more radiation from the sun to be taken in. The following spring, however, the land within the area of the fire was brighter than before the fire, because fewer trees covered the ground. Snow on the ground mirrored more sunlight back into space, leading to cooling.
“We need to find out all possible ways to reduce the growth of greenhouse gases in the atmosphere.” Scientists tracked the change in amount of radiation entering and leaving the climate system as a result of the fire, and found a measurement closely related to the global air temperature. Typically, fire in northern regions occurs in the same area every 80 to 150 years. Scientists, however, found that when fire occurs more frequently, more radiation is lost from the earth and cooling results. Specifically, they determined when fire returns 20 years earlier than predicated, 0.5 watts per square meter of area burned are soaked up by the earth from greenhouse gases, but 0.9 watts per square meter will be sent back into space. The net effect is cooling. At one time, computers were expected largely to remove the need for paper copies of documents (文件) because they could be stored electronically. But for all the texts that are written, stored and sent electronically, a lot of them are still ending up on paper.
It is difficult to measure the quantity of paper used as a result of use of Internetconnected computers, although just about anyone who works in an office can tell you that when e-mail is introduced, the printers start working overtime.
“I feel in my bones this revolution is causing more trees to be cut down," says Ted Smith of the Earth Village Organisation.
Perhaps the best sign of how computer and Internet use pushes up demand for paper comes from the hightech industry itself, which sees printing as one of its most promising new markets. Several Internet companies have been set up to help small businesses print quality documents from a computer. Earlier this week HewlettPackard Co. announced a plan to develop new technologies that will enable people to print even more so they can get a hard copy of a business document, a medical record or just a oneline email, even if they are nowhere near a computer. As the company sees it, the more use of the Internet the greater demand for printers.
Does all this mean environmental concerns (环境问题) have been forgotten? Some activists suggest people have been led to believe that a lot of dangers to the environment have gone away.“ I guess people believe that the problem is taken care of, because of recycling(回收利用)," said Kelly Quirke, director of the Rainforest Action Network in San Francisco. Yet Quirke is hopeful that hightech may also prove helpful. He says printers that print on both sides are growing in popularity. The action group has also found acceptable paper made from materials other than wood, such as agricultural waste.

A newspaper in Helsinki,Finland,recently published a cartoon of a baby with a mobile phone,telling his parents that his diaper(尿布) needed changing.But it's hardly a joke.Helsinki is home to Nokia,the mobilephone maker.It's one of the most “mobile”cities in the world.About 92 percent of its households have at least one mobile phone.And the kids start young.
“A relatively normal age to get a mobile phone is now 7,”says Jan Virkki,marketing manager for a mobile phone company.Among the second graders at the Kulosaari Elementary School,the most popular object of desire this year is not a Barbie or a Gameboy.It is a Nokia mobile phone with a picture of their own choice on the screen.
“One of the first things we discuss when school starts is the rules for mobile phones,”says Tiia Korppi,a teacher.Among the rules:You have to put it away out of sight.You cannot turn it on.You cannot send text messages to your friends,or play amusing tunes(令人发笑的曲调)in class,or call your parents or call for a pizza during history.

Tristan da Cunha, a 38squaremile island, is the farthest inhabited island in the world, according to the Guinness Book of Records. It is 1,510 miles southwest
of its nearest neighbor, St.Helena, and 1,950 miles west of Africa. Discovered
by the Portuguese admiral(葡萄牙海军上将)of the same name in 1506, and settled
in 1810, the island belongs to Great Britain and has a population of a few hund
red.
Coming in a close second—and often wrongly mentioned as the most distant land—is Easter Island, which lies 1,260 miles east of its nearest neighbor, Pitcair
n Island, and 2,300 miles west of South America.
The mountainous 64-square-mile island was settled around the 5th century, supposedly by people who were lost at sea. They had no connection with the outside world for more than a thousand years, giving them plenty of time to build more than 1,000 huge stone figures, called moai, for which the island is most famous.
On Easter Sunday, 1722, however, settlers from Holland moved in and gave the island its name. Today, 2,000 people live on the Chilean territory (智利领土).They share one street, a small airport, and a few hours of television per day.

There are three separate sources of danger in supplying energy by nuclear power(原子能).
First, the radioactive material must travel from its place of production to the power station. Although the power stations themselves are strongly built, the containers used for the transport of the materials are not. Normally, only two methods of transport are in use, namely road or rail. Unfortunately, both of these may have an effect on the general public, since they are sure to pass near, or even through, heavily populated areas.
Second, there is the problem of waste. All nuclear power stations produce wastes that in most cases will remain radioactive for thousands of years. It is impossible to make these wastes nonradioactive, and so they must be stored in one of the inconvenient ways that scientists have invented. For example, they may be buried under the ground, or dropped into deserted mines, or sunk in the sea. However, these methods do not solve the problem, since an earthquake could easily break the containers.
Third, there may occur the danger of a leak(泄漏) or an explosion at the power station. As with the other two dangers, this is not very likely, so it does not provide a serious objection to the nuclear program. However, it can happen.Separately, these three types of dangers are not a great cause for worry. Taken together, though, the probability of disaster(灾难) is extremely high.

When a group of children politely stop a conversation with you, saying,“We have to go to work now.” you're left feeling surprised and certainly uneasy. After all, this is the 1990s and the idea of children working is just unthinkable. That is , until you are told that they are all pupils of stage schools, and that the “work” they go off to is to go on the stage in a theatre.
Stage schools often act as agencies (代理机构) to supply children for stage and television work. More worthy of the name “stage school” are those few places where children attend full time, with a training for the theatre and a general education.
A visit to such schools will leave you in no doubt that the children enjoy themselves. After all, what lively children wouldn't settle for spending only hal
f the day doing ordinary school work, and acting, singing or dancing their way through the other half of the day?
Then of course there are times for the children to make a name and make a little money in some big shows. Some stage schools give their children too much professional work at such a young age. But the law is very tight on the amount they can do. Those under 13 are limited to 40 days in the year; those over 13 do 80 days.
The schools themselves admit that not all children will be successful in the profession for which they are being trained. So what happens to those who don't make it? While all the leading schools say they place great importance on children getting good study results, the facts seem to suggest this is not always the case.
